School Speech Therapist | Columbus, Nebraska
Columbus, NE
A K-12 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) position is available for the upcoming school year in Columbus, NE. This contract role involves providing essential speech and language support to students from kindergarten through 12th grade in a dynamic educational setting.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assess, diagnose, and treat speech, language, and communication disorders in students
- Collaborate with educators and parents to develop and implement individualized education plans (IEPs)
- Monitor student progress and adjust interventions as needed
- Maintain detailed records and documentation in compliance with educational standards and policies
- Participate in multidisciplinary team meetings to support student success
Qualifications:
- Valid state licensure or certification as a Speech-Language Pathologist
- Experience working with K-12 students, preferably in a school setting
- Strong knowledge of speech and language development, disorders, and evidence-based therapy techniques
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team
Location:
- Columbus, Nebraska – serving students in grades Kindergarten through 12
